    For most companies outsourcing should be a short term solution. Initial competitive advantages (lower costs) degrade over time, but the disadvantages stick (longer line of communications, less control over the final product; typically workers with lesser skillset). This is why, for example, India is still not the Mecca of IT outsourcing it once was predicted to be(come).

    Another thing I forgot is actually its twice the work for management if you outsource and have very tight supply lines you have to continually be in contact with suppliers and even there subsuppliers to ensure smooth production. Little nugget from my own experience is when there was a fire in one of the INTEL fabs it affected Motorolla badly cos there supply lines were very tight and they lost serious market share. There competitors bought all the chips availabe because they did not just rely on the say so of INTEL that production would be back ontrack soon and of course Motorolla had no way to make there own chips.
